The Duties of Medical Assistants

medical assistant with Stillwater OK nursing home patientThe function of a medical assistant can be varied as well as demanding. Essentially their job is to make sure that the Stillwater OK clinics, hospitals and other medical care centers where they work run efficiently. Based on the type or size of facility, they may be more of an administrative assistant, a clinical assistant, or in smaller practices both. They are tasked with giving direct support to the nurses, doctors and other medical practitioners but can also be found performing duties at the front desk or in an office. A few of the many duties of a medical assistant include:

  • Filling out insurance forms and filing claims
  • Setting and confirming appointments
  • Taking vital signs and weighing patients
  • Collecting blood and other tissue and fluid samples
  • Preparing rooms and instruments for doctors
  • Supplying general support during exams and procedures

Even though medical assistants can carry out almost any duty they are authorized to under Oklahoma law, some choose to specialize in a particular area and attain certification. Two of the options offered are for the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) and the Certified Medical Administrative Assistant (CMAA) made available by the National Healthcareer Association (NHA).

Medical Assistant Education

In contrast to most other medical practitioners, medical assistants are not required to become licensed, certified, or to earn a college degree. However, many Stillwater OK health care employers would rather hire graduates of an accredited medical assistant training school (more on accreditation later ) that are certified. There are essentially two options offered for a formal education. The first and fastest route to becoming a medical assistant is to earn a diploma or a certificate. These programs typically take about one year to complete, some as little as six to nine months. They are created to teach the fundamentals of medical assisting and ready graduates for entry level positions. The second option is to attain an Associate Degree, which are usually two year programs available at community and junior colleges together with vocational and technical schools. They are more expansive in nature than the diploma or certificate programs, and include liberal arts courses in addition to the medical assistant courses. They usually have a clinical element involving an internship with a local medical facility. Associate Degrees are routinely a pre-requisite for and credits can be applied to a four year Bachelor’s Degree in Medical Assistant Studies or a related field.

Certification Programs for Medical Assistants

As previously mentioned, becoming certified is not a legal mandate, but is a good idea for individuals who want to advance their careers. It will not only help in securing employment after graduation, but it might also help with preliminary salary negotiations. Many potential Stillwater OK medical employers just will not employ a medical assistant that has not attained accredited formal training or certification. Among the most popular and possibly the most respected certification is the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) offered by the American Association of Medical Assistants (AAMA). To qualify to apply for the CMA exam, an applicant must be a graduate or will be graduating within 30 days from an accredited medical assistant program. Alternative certifications are offered also, for instance the CMAA and the CCMA that we discussed earlier which are offered by the NHA.

Is the Medical Assistant Course Accredited? There are a number of great reasons to make certain that the school you enroll in is accredited. To begin with, accreditation helps guarantee that the training you receive will be both comprehensive and of the highest quality. Next, if you intend to become certified, you need to enroll in an accredited program. Two of the approved agencies for accreditation are the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P) and the Accrediting Bureau of Health Education Schools (ABHES). If your school is not accredited by either of these organizations, you will not be qualified to take the CMA exam. Also, if you intend on obtaining a student loan or financial aid, they are frequently not offered for non-accredited programs. And finally, as mentioned previously, many potential Stillwater OK employers will not hire a medical assistant who has not graduated from an accredited school.

Stillwater, Oklahoma

Stillwater is a city in northeast Oklahoma at the intersection of US-177 and State Highway 51. It is the county seat of Payne County, Oklahoma, United States. As of 2012, the city population was estimated to be 46,560, making it the tenth largest city in Oklahoma. Stillwater is the principal city of the Stillwater Micropolitan Statistical Area which had a population of 78,399 according to the 2012 census estimate. Stillwater was part of the first Oklahoma Land Run held on April 22, 1889 when the Unassigned Lands were opened for settlement and became the core of the new Oklahoma Territory. The city charter was adopted on August 24, 1889.[5] Stillwater is home to the main campus of Oklahoma State University as well as Northern Oklahoma College - Stillwater, Meridian Technology Center, and the Oklahoma Department of Career and Technology Education.

Stillwater has a diverse economy with a foundation in aerospace, agribusiness, biotechnology, optoelectronics, printing and publishing, and software and standard manufacturing. The city operates under a council-manager government system. The city's largest employer is Oklahoma State University. It was one of the 100 Best Places to Live in 2010, according to CNN Money Magazine.[6]

The north-central region of Oklahoma became part of the United States with the Louisiana Purchase in 1803. In 1832, author and traveler Washington Irving provided the first recorded description of the area around Stillwater in his book A Tour on the Prairies. He wrote of “a glorious prairie spreading out beneath the golden beams of an autumnal sun. The deep and frequent traces of buffalo, showed it to be a one of their favorite grazing grounds.”[8]
